ZIP code 98847 covers Peshastin, Washington, with a population of about 2,034 and a median household income of $72,139.

Peshastin, Washington — the area the Census Bureau draws for this ZIP code. ZIP codes are sets of delivery routes rather than areas, so this is the Census approximation of one, not a Postal Service boundary.
